Salary/Hourly Rate: £12.70 Per Hour
Location: Bursom Rd, Leicester, LE4 1BS
Reporting to: Regional Manager
Hours/working pattern: This is a full-time role of 37.5 hours per week, worked across 5 out of 7 days (Monday to Sunday). Flexibility is required to meet business needs, and specific working days and hours will be discussed during the interview process (Various hours from early starts like 6 AM)
Contractual Requirements: Candidates must be aged 18+
We’re currently recruiting for an ambitious Apprentice Chef to help us create exceptional food experiences for Dine on a full-time basis contracted to 37.5 hours per week.
As an apprentice chef you will be working in a passionate and hard-working team to create an outstanding culinary experience for our customers. In return, you will have the chance to progress your career with a company that invests in its people, celebrates individuality, and rewards and recognises employees who go beyond the plate.
You do not need to have any experience to apply for this vacancy as full training will be provided as part of the apprenticeship!
On completion of the Apprenticeship you will achieve the Production Chef L2 and become a qualified Chef
Your Key Responsibilities Will Include:
- Supporting the kitchen team prepare and cook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ner
- Preparing delicious, high-quality food that delights our clients and customers
- Identifying opportunities to improve our food services
- Listening and acting on customer feedback to consistently improve our food services
- Supporting with the creation of new menus and creative food concepts
- Representing DINE and maintaining a positive brand image
- Monitoring inventories to keep our kitchens well-stocked
- Overseeing kitchen cleaning responsibilities to maintain hygiene standards
- Complying with Food Handling, Hygiene and Health and Satefty regulations

This apprentice vacancy is based within our Dine sector, Dine provides tailored food services to 140 clients in the business and industry sector. With over two decades of industry experience, we pride ourselves on offering a personalised approach to our clients, whilst delivering outstanding service. Our passion lies in creating great-tasting menus, promoting sustainability, and proudly working with local suppliers and communities. That\'s why our menus feature only locally sourced, seasonal, and sustainable ingredients with a target of reaching Climate Zero by 2030.
